How We Work
1
Emergency Call
Your urgent call to Damage Restoration Company Akron activates our rapid response. We gather critical details about the water damage, dispatching a certified team immediately. Our goal is to arrive quickly.
2
On-Site Assessment
Upon arrival, our Akron technicians perform a thorough inspection, utilizing moisture meters and thermal imaging to precisely locate all affected areas. This comprehensive assessment informs our detailed action plan.
3
Water Extraction & Drying
We deploy industrial-grade pumps and powerful extractors to remove standing water efficiently. High-capacity air movers and dehumidifiers then dry the structure, preventing secondary damage and mold growth.
4
Cleaning & Sanitization
All affected surfaces and contents undergo meticulous cleaning, sanitization, and deodorization. We use EPA-approved antimicrobial agents to inhibit mold and bacterial growth, ensuring a safe environment.
5
Restoration & Repair
Our skilled team rebuilds and repairs damaged structural elements. This final phase restores your property to its pre-damage condition, completing the restoration process with quality craftsmanship.

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ost In Wickliffe, OH

The cost of tile floor water damage restoration in Wickliffe, OH can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on the specific needs of your property and our commitment to delivering the best results possible.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response $500 - $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Water Extraction $1,000 - $5,000 Volume of water, complexity of extraction
Drying and Dehumidification $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area, local conditions
Cleaning and Disinfecting $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required
Repair and Restoration $1,000 - $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
